C language and Python: analysis of applicable scenarios and advantages and disadvantages
In the field of computer programming, C language and Python are two very popular programming languages. They each have their own characteristics. Unique advantages and disadvantages, suitable for different scenarios. This article will conduct an in-depth analysis of C language and Python, discussing their applicable scenarios, advantages and disadvantages.
1. C language
- Applicable scenarios:
C language is a process-oriented programming language with high efficiency and excellent performance. Suitable for developing system software, drivers and embedded systems that require a high degree of control and efficiency. Due to its ability to directly operate memory, the C language can better handle low-level details and is suitable for application scenarios that require high computing performance.
- Advantages:
- High performance: Programs written in C language execute quickly and are suitable for applications with strict performance requirements.
- Strong control ability: C language can directly operate memory and hardware, giving better control over system resources.
- Platform independence: C language has high portability and can be compiled and run on different platforms.
- Disadvantages:
- Complex syntax: C language requires developers to manually manage memory, which is prone to problems such as memory leaks and out-of-bounds access.
- Low development efficiency: Compared with high-level languages, C language requires more code to achieve the same function.
Sample code:
#include <stdio.h> int main() { int a = 5; int b = 10; int c = a + b; printf("The sum of a and b is: %d ", c); return 0; }
2. Python
- Applicable scenarios:
Python is an interpreted A high-level programming language with concise and easy-to-read syntax and a rich standard library, suitable for rapid development of prototypes and applications, data analysis, artificial intelligence and other fields. Due to its high development efficiency and extensive community support, Python is widely used in web development, scientific computing, automated testing and other fields.
- Advantages:
- Concise and easy to read: Python syntax is concise, elegant, and easy to learn and understand.
- High development efficiency: Python has a wealth of third-party libraries and tools, which can quickly develop prototypes and applications.
- Large and active community: Python has a large developer community and rich resources, and it is easy to find solutions to problems.
- Disadvantages:
- Low performance: Python is an interpreted language, runs slowly, and is not suitable for applications with extremely high performance requirements. .
- Not suitable for low-level operations: Due to Python's high abstraction level, it cannot directly operate memory and hardware.
Sample code:
# Python示例代码 a = 5 b = 10 c = a + b print("The sum of a and b is:", c)
Summary:
C language is suitable for scenarios with high performance requirements and low-level control, while Python is suitable for applications that are quickly developed and easy to maintain. When developers choose a programming language, they should choose appropriate tools based on actual needs, give full play to the advantages of the language, and improve development efficiency and program performance.

The DOM and SAX methods can be used to parse XML data in C. 1) DOM parsing loads XML into memory, suitable for small files, but may take up a lot of memory. 2) SAX parsing is event-driven and is suitable for large files, but cannot be accessed randomly. Choosing the right method and optimizing the code can improve efficiency.

You can use the TinyXML, Pugixml, or libxml2 libraries to process XML data in C. 1) Parse XML files: Use DOM or SAX methods, DOM is suitable for small files, and SAX is suitable for large files. 2) Generate XML file: convert the data structure into XML format and write to the file. Through these steps, XML data can be effectively managed and manipulated.
